What is the relationship between Ka and pKb? Does pKb go down if Ka goes up? Also, what pKa and Ka produce a strong conjugate base?

pKa and pKb are the -log of Ka and Kb. As the exponent of the K becomes more negative, pKa or b increases

It's better to remember the relation between Ka and pKa (vice versa with Kb) but the smaller the value of Ka, then the larger the value of pKa and thus the weaker the acid, if a weak acid has a small Ka value it's conjugate base will have a large Kb value
